We need to clarify about the shipping issue. Normally we ship within a day from your order. But last week we ran out of stocks (as some of you have noted) so we have to bring express mail a few from somewhere to meet the demand. It will take a few days for the shipment to arrive, but we decided to allow people to place order. The estimated ship date is where we will be able to ship out (typically we can ship out 1 or 2 days earlier). The shipping method that you choose determine the time it takes to ship STARTING FROM THE ESTIMATED SHIP DATE, not from your order placement date!

Anyway, if you want to change the shipping method, email directsales and we can give you a refund after shipment Amazon.com doesn't allow merchants to alter the order or view customer's credit card. All we can do is confirmed or canceled. Then make adjustment with refund after shipping confirmation.

Unfortunately, no one here on Head-Fi has been able to review the NE-8s and NE-7Ms head to head. So it's really been a toss-up in terms of which to buy.

As an NE-8 owner, I can tell you that the music produced from them sound excellent. I only say that they are a bit bass anemic probably because I'm comparing the NE-8s to my $400 IEMs such as my TF10s and W3s (kindof unfair). All in all though, the NE-8s sound great, the soundstage is good, details are good, and the bass is very clean.

I think that your decision to get the NE-7M or the NE-8 comes down to your personal preference. Do you want something with a bit fuller bass? Go with the NE-7M. NE-8s supposedly have greater detailed mids and treble, so maybe you'll prefer that. If I were you, I would just 1) flip a coin. Or 2) get the NE-7M. It has a built in microphone and it's about $8 cheaper
